What is NM cable type?

The NM represents the type of sheath on the cable. NM stands for Non Metallic sheath cable..


Do electrical wire cables have to be clamped with cable connectors when they enter electrical panel box?

For cable not in conduit and intended to be installed without conduit, such as NM cable, yes. You must provide some form of connector that will hold the cable in place. A clamp is not the only kind of connector that will do this but is the most common.

What does NM STAND FOR ON ROMEX WIRE?

NM on Romex wire stands for "Non-Metallic." This type of electrical cable is commonly used for residential wiring and is designed for indoor use. The non-metallic sheathing provides insulation and protection for the individual conductors inside, making it easier to install and less prone to corrosion. NM cable is typically used in dry locations and is suitable for general-purpose circuits.


What is 14-3 nm-b wire?

14-3 NM-B wire is a type of electrical wire used for residential wiring in non-metallic sheathed cable applications. The "14" indicates the gauge of the wire, meaning it has a diameter suitable for carrying up to 15 amps of current. The "3" signifies that the cable contains three insulated conductors (typically black, white, and bare or green for ground). NM-B stands for "non-metallic sheathed cable," which is designed for indoor use and is resistant to moisture and corrosion.

Ideally NM or armored cable should be installed in a wall stud at least how far from the front edge of the stud?

NM (non-metallic) or armored cable should ideally be installed at least 1 1/4 inches from the front edge of the stud. This distance helps protect the cable from potential damage caused by nails or screws that may be driven into the wall. Proper placement also ensures compliance with electrical codes and enhances the safety of the installation.
